Heung-Soo is responsible for checking a shipment of technology equipment that contains laser printers that cost \(700 each and color monitors that cost \)200 each. He counts 30 boxes on the loading dock. The invoice states that the order totals $15,000.

Write a system of two equations that represents the number of each item.

1Step-1 – Apply the concept of system of equations

A set of two or more equations with the same variables is called a system of linear equations. The ordered pairs that satisfy all the equations in the system is called as solution of the equations.

2Step-2 – Formation of the equations

Let us suppose the number of boxes of laser printers be and the number of boxes of color monitors be y.

Now according to the question, the total number of boxes are 30.

The first equation so formed is below.

x+y=30

3Step-3 – Formation of the equations

Consider the second statement.

The invoice states the order total to be of $15,000. The cost of each laser printer is $700 and that of color monitor is $200, which is mathematically expressed in the equation as shown.

700x+200y=15,0007x+2y=150

Hence, both the equations so formed for the given question are 

x+y=307x+2y=150
